Me and a friend came in for lunch and i ordered a katsu curry which the sauce was obviously pre made and tasted OK but lacking fresh flavour, rice mediocre, but worst of all the chicken was hardly cooked and very worrying, my cheesy chips were still frozen in the centre yet my cheese was melted which brings me to believe they were potentially microwaved. Had to leave most of the food. My friend ordered chicken bites which were a velvet purple kind of colour in the middle and were scarily wobbly on the inside. Her chips were also hard in the middle and tasted like cotton had to leave them to avoid illness ,then order a flapjack which was so rock solid i thought it was frozen and nearly bent my knife. Overall 1/5 avoid like the plague Meal type: Lunch Price per person: £10–20 Food: 1 Service: 2 Atmosphere: 2

Probably one of the worst breakfasts I have ever eaten. The food was cold, and more than likely all microwaved. Sausages were raw in the middle, as they hadn't been cooked long enough. Hash browns still had ice on them. The only thing edible was the toast. Should have known straight away from the cold customer service you receive as you order. The staff flap their arms around, and it's clear that they don't want to be there. Avoid the customer toilet! The sign on the door says it's not been cleaned since 9th October, and it's pretty clear that's probably the last time they were cleaned. Didn't even eat 1/3 of our breakfast as it was genuinely awful. Meal type: Brunch Price per person: £1–10 Food: 1 Service: 1 Atmosphere: 2

Great place for a quiet coffee and cake. It appears to be a secret Costa as all coffee and biscuits are branded Costa. They all do meals for £6.99 or 2 for £10 which is a great deal. Also it is never too busy here even at lunchtime so it's a great place to get a Costa in quieter surroundings. Please don't tell anyone else it will get too busy ... Meal type: Lunch Price per person: £1–10 Food: 5 Service: 5 Atmosphere: 5
